Function FTI_CM_ACCT_NAME_READ pattern details
In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.CALL FUNCTION 'FTI_CM_ACCT_NAME_READ'"Determine Text for Cash Management Account Name for Text Reader.
EXPORTING
I_BUKRS = "Company Code
I_DISKB = "Cash Management Account Name
IMPORTING
E_TEXTL = "Text zur dispositiven Kontobezeichnung

IMPORTING Parameters details for FTI_CM_ACCT_NAME_READ
I_BUKRS - Company Code
Data type: T035U-BUKRSOptional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
I_DISKB - Cash Management Account Name
Data type: T035U-DISKBOptional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
EXPORTING Parameters details for FTI_CM_ACCT_NAME_READ
E_TEXTL - Text zur dispositiven Kontobezeichnung
Data type: T035U-TEXTLOptional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
